REPAIRD

Repaird

Repaird7 Charterhouse Bldgs, Barbican, London EC1M 7AN, United Kingdom+442081269899https://www.repaird.uk/Data Recovery in LondonLaptop computer Maintenance: Being familiar with the value of Expert Take care of Your MachineLaptops are an essential section of recent existence, serving as equipment for do the job, education, entertainment, and intera

read more